Deep Learning เลียนแบบการเรียนรู้ของมนุษย์ ให้คอมพิวเตอร์วิเคราะห์ข้อมูลด้วยโมเดลโครงข่ายประสาทเทียมหลายชั้น ซึ่งมีประโยชน์มากมาย แต่ก็มีข้อจำกัดที่ต้องพิจารณา

Deep Learning คือสาขาหนึ่งของ AI ที่กำลังได้รับความสนใจอย่างมาก เพราะสามารถสอนให้คอมพิวเตอร์เรียนรู้จากข้อมูลจำนวนมหาศาลได้ คล้ายกับวิธีการเรียนรู้ของมนุษย์ ทำให้สามารถนำไปประยุกต์ใช้งานได้อย่างกว้างขวาง ทั้งในด้านการจำแนกข้อมูล การรู้จำภาพและเสียง หรือแม้แต่การสร้างเนื้อหาใหม่ๆ แต่การพัฒนา Deep Learning ก็มีความท้าทายที่ต้องเผชิญอยู่ไม่น้อย

คุณอาจสนใจ:

Deep Learning คืออะไร

Deep learning เป็นสาขาหนึ่งของ machine learning และ artificial intelligence (AI) ที่เลียนแบบวิธีการเรียนรู้ของมนุษย์ โมเดล deep learning สามารถถูกสอนให้ทำงานจำแนกประเภทและรู้จำรูปแบบในรูปภาพ ข้อความ เสียง และข้อมูลอื่นๆ ได้ นอกจากนี้ยังใช้เพื่อทำให้งานที่ปกติต้องอาศัยความฉลาดของมนุษย์ เช่น การอธิบายรูปภาพหรือการถอดเสียงเป็นข้อความ สามารถทำได้โดยอัตโนมัติ

Deep learning เป็นองค์ประกอบสำคัญของวิทยาศาสตร์ข้อมูล ซึ่งรวมถึงสถิติและการทำนายผล ซึ่งมีประโยชน์อย่างมากสำหรับนักวิทยาศาสตร์ข้อมูลที่มีหน้าที่ในการเก็บรวบรวม วิเคราะห์ และตีความข้อมูลจำนวนมาก โดย deep learning ช่วยให้กระบวนการนี้เร็วขึ้นและง่ายขึ้น

ทำไม Deep Learning จึงสำคัญ

Deep learning ต้องอาศัยข้อมูลที่มีป้ายกำกับจำนวนมากและพลังการประมวลผล หากองค์กรสามารถรองรับความต้องการทั้งสองอย่างได้ ก็สามารถนำ deep learning ไปใช้ในด้านต่างๆ เช่น ผู้ช่วยดิจิทัล การตรวจจับการฉ้อโกง และการจดจำใบหน้า นอกจากนี้ deep learning ยังมีความแม่นยำในการรู้จำสูง ซึ่งเป็นสิ่งสำคัญสำหรับการประยุกต์ใช้งานอื่นๆ ที่ความปลอดภัยเป็นปัจจัยสำคัญ เช่น รถยนต์ไร้คนขับหรืออุปกรณ์การแพทย์

Deep Learning ทำงานอย่างไร

โปรแกรมคอมพิวเตอร์ที่ใช้ deep learning จะผ่านกระบวนการเดียวกับเด็กที่กำลังเรียนรู้ที่จะระบุสุนัขเป็นต้น

โปรแกรม deep learning มีหลายชั้นของโหนดที่เชื่อมโยงกัน โดยแต่ละชั้นจะสร้างขึ้นบนชั้นก่อนหน้าเพื่อปรับปรุงและเพิ่มประสิทธิภาพการทำนายและการจำแนก Deep learning ทำการแปลงแบบไม่เชิงเส้นกับข้อมูลที่ป้อนเข้าไปและใช้สิ่งที่เรียนรู้มาเพื่อสร้างโมเดลทางสถิติเป็นผลลัพธ์ วนซ้ำไปเรื่อยๆ จนกว่าผลลัพธ์จะมีความแม่นยำที่ยอมรับได้ จำนวนชั้นการประมวลผลที่ข้อมูลต้องผ่านคือสิ่งที่ทำให้เรียกว่า deep

การเรียนรู้ของเครื่องแบบดั้งเดิม กระบวนการเรียนรู้จะมีการกำกับดูแล และโปรแกรมเมอร์ต้องระบุอย่างละเอียดมากว่าต้องการให้คอมพิวเตอร์มองหาอะไรเพื่อตัดสินใจว่ารูปภาพมีหรือไม่มีสุนัข นี่เป็นกระบวนการที่ยุ่งยากเรียกว่าการสกัดคุณลักษณะ และอัตราความสำเร็จของคอมพิวเตอร์ขึ้นอยู่กับความสามารถของโปรแกรมเมอร์ในการกำหนดชุดคุณลักษณะสำหรับสุนัขได้อย่างแม่นยำ ข้อดีของ deep learning คือโปรแกรมสร้างชุดคุณลักษณะด้วยตัวเองโดยไม่ต้องมีการกำกับดูแล

วิธีการ Deep Learning

สามารถใช้วิธีการต่างๆ เพื่อสร้างโมเดล deep learning ที่แข็งแกร่ง เทคนิคเหล่านี้ ได้แก่ learning rate decay, transfer learning, training from scratch และ dropout

1. Learning rate decay – เป็นกระบวนการปรับ learning rate เพื่อเพิ่มประสิทธิภาพและลดเวลาในการฝึก

2. Transfer learning – เป็นกระบวนการปรับปรุงโมเดลที่ผ่านการฝึกมาแล้ว และต้องการอินเทอร์เฟซไปยังส่วนภายในของเครือข่ายที่มีอยู่ วิธีนี้ใช้ข้อมูลน้อยกว่าวิธีอื่นๆ จึงช่วยลดเวลาในการคำนวณเป็นนาทีหรือชั่วโมง

3. Training from scratch – ต้องการให้ผู้พัฒนารวบรวมชุดข้อมูลที่มีป้ายกำกับขนาดใหญ่ แล้วกำหนดค่าสถาปัตยกรรมเครือข่ายที่สามารถเรียนรู้คุณลักษณะและโมเดลได้ วิธีนี้เป็นประโยชน์อย่างยิ่งสำหรับแอปพลิเคชันใหม่ อย่างไรก็ตามต้องการข้อมูลมหาศาล ทำให้ใช้เวลาหลายวันหรือหลายสัปดาห์

4. Dropout – เป็นวิธีที่พยายามแก้ปัญหา overfitting ในเครือข่ายที่มีพารามิเตอร์จำนวนมาก โดยการลบหน่วยและการเชื่อมต่อแบบสุ่มออกจากโครงข่ายประสาทระหว่างการฝึกอบรม ซึ่งพิสูจน์แล้วว่าสามารถปรับปรุงประสิทธิภาพได้

โครงข่ายประสาทเทียมแบบ Deep Learning

อัลกอริทึม machine learning ขั้นสูงชนิดหนึ่ง ที่เรียกว่า artificial neural network (ANN) เป็นรากฐานสำคัญของโมเดล deep learning ดังนั้น deep learning จึงอาจเรียกว่า deep neural learning หรือ deep neural network (DNN) ได้ด้วย

DNN ประกอบด้วยชั้นอินพุต ชั้นซ่อน และชั้นเอาต์พุต โหนดอินพุตทำหน้าที่เป็นชั้นวางข้อมูลอินพุต จำนวนชั้นและโหนดเอาต์พุตที่ต้องการจะเปลี่ยนไปตามเอาต์พุต ส่วนชั้นซ่อนเป็นชั้นหลายชั้นที่ประมวลผลและส่งผ่านข้อมูลไปยังชั้นอื่นๆ ในโครงข่ายประสาท

ข้อดีของ Deep Learning

 • การเรียนรู้คุณลักษณะอัตโนมัติ – ระบบ deep learning สามารถสกัดคุณลักษณะได้โดยอัตโนมัติ หมายความว่าไม่จำเป็นต้องมีการดูแลเพื่อเพิ่มคุณลักษณะใหม่
 • การค้นพบรูปแบบ – ระบบ deep learning สามารถวิเคราะห์ข้อมูลจำนวนมากและค้นหารูปแบบที่ซับซ้อนในรูปภาพ ข้อความ และเสียง และสามารถสรุปข้อมูลเชิงลึกที่อาจไม่ได้รับการฝึกอบรมด้วยก็ได้
 • ประมวลผลชุดข้อมูลที่ผันผวน – ระบบ deep learning สามารถจัดหมวดหมู่และจัดเรียงชุดข้อมูลที่มีความแปรปรวนสูงได้ เช่น ในระบบธุรกรรมและการฉ้อโกง
 • ประเภทข้อมูล – ระบบ deep learning สามารถประมวลผลทั้งข้อมูลแบบมีโครงสร้างและไม่มีโครงสร้าง
 • ความแม่นยำ – การเพิ่มชั้นโหนดใดๆ จะช่วยเพิ่มประสิทธิภาพความแม่นยำของโมเดล deep learning
 • สามารถทำได้มากกว่าวิธีการ machine learning อื่นๆ – เมื่อเทียบกับกระบวนการ machine learning ทั่วไป deep learning ต้องการการแทรกแซงจากมนุษย์น้อยกว่า และสามารถวิเคราะห์ข้อมูลที่การ machine learning อื่นๆ ทำได้ไม่ดีเท่า

ตัวอย่างการใช้ Deep Learning

Deep learning ถูกนำไปใช้ในเทคโนโลยีทั่วไปต่างๆ เช่น ระบบจดจำใบหน้าอัตโนมัติ ผู้ช่วยดิจิทัล และการตรวจจับการฉ้อโกง รวมถึงเทคโนโลยีใหม่ๆ ด้วย เช่น

 • การตรวจจับภาวะเพ้อคลั่งในผู้ป่วยวิกฤต
 • การตรวจหาเซลล์มะเร็งโดยอัตโนมัติ
 • ใช้ในรถยนต์ไร้คนขับเพื่อตรวจจับวัตถุ เช่น ป้ายจราจรหรือคนเดินถนนโดยอัตโนมัติ
 • ใช้เพื่อการกลั่นกรองเนื้อหาในโซเชียลมีเดีย

ข้อจำกัดและความท้าทาย

ระบบ deep learning มีข้อเสียด้วย เช่น:

 • เรียนรู้จากการสังเกตเท่านั้น หมายความว่ารู้แค่สิ่งที่อยู่ในข้อมูลที่นำมาฝึกเท่านั้น
 • เรื่องอคติเป็นปัญหาใหญ่สำหรับโมเดล deep learning หากโมเดลฝึกบนข้อมูลที่มีอคติ โมเดลจะสร้างอคติในการทำนายด้วยเช่นกัน
 • อัตราการเรียนรู้ หากสูงเกินไปโมเดลจะลู่เข้าเร็วเกินไป ได้ผลลัพธ์ที่ไม่ดีที่สุด แต่หากต่ำเกินไป กระบวนการอาจติดอยู่และยากที่จะหาทางออก
 • ความต้องการด้านฮาร์ดแวร์ เช่น GPU แบบมัลติคอร์ประสิทธิภาพสูง ซึ่งมีราคาแพงและใช้พลังงานมาก
 • ต้องการข้อมูลจำนวนมาก และยิ่งต้องการโมเดลที่ทรงพลังและแม่นยำมากเท่าไร ก็ยิ่งต้องการพารามิเตอร์มากขึ้นและต้องการข้อมูลมากขึ้น

สรุป

Deep Learning ถือเป็นเทคโนโลยี AI ที่กำลังเติบโตอย่างรวดเร็ว มีศักยภาพในการปฏิวัติอุตสาหกรรมและวงการต่างๆ อย่างมหาศาล ด้วยความสามารถในการเรียนรู้และวิเคราะห์ข้อมูลอย่างลึกซึ้ง อย่างไรก็ตาม การพัฒนา Deep Learning ให้มีประสิทธิภาพสูงสุดนั้น ต้องอาศัยทั้งความเชี่ยวชาญ ทรัพยากรด้าน computing ที่มหาศาล และการแก้ไขข้อจำกัดต่างๆ ให้ได้ ซึ่งยังคงเป็นความท้าทายสำคัญที่ทุกคนจับตามอง

คุณอาจสนใจ:

แหล่งอ้างอิง:

บทความที่เกี่ยวข้อง

คอนเทนต์ครีเอเตอร์สหรัฐฯ เครียด! สภาสนับสนุนร่างกฎหมายแบน TikTok

TikTok และคอนเทนต์ครีเอเตอร์สหรัฐฯ เผชิญความตึงเครียดหลังสภาผู้แทนราษฎรของสหรัฐฯ สนับสนุนร่างกฎหมายบังคับให้แยกตัวออกจาก ByteDance แห่งประเทศจีน

อ่านต่อ »

Y2K คืออะไร: ย้อนรอยตำนานหายนะคอมพิวเตอร์ที่ไม่เคยเกิดขึ้นจริง

Y2K คืออะไร? ย้อนรอยตำนานหายนะคอมพิวเตอร์ที่ไม่เคยเกิดขึ้นจริง และบทเรียนสำคัญสู่โลกอนาคต มนุษยชาติเรียนรู้อะไรบ้าง…

อ่านต่อ »

Machine Learning คืออะไร

Machine Learning กำลังก้าวเข้ามามีบทบาทสำคัญในการเปลี่ยนแปลงโลกของเรา ทั้งการทำงาน ธุรกิจ และชีวิตประจำวัน มาทำความรู้จักและเตรียมพร้อมสำหรับโลกแห่งอนาคตไปด้วยกัน

อ่านต่อ »

GPT-3 คืออะไร

GPT-3 ปัญญาประดิษฐ์อัจฉริยะ สร้างข้อความเสมือนมนุษย์เขียน เปิดโลกแห่งการสร้างสรรค์ไร้ขีดจำกัด คุณพร้อมสำรวจศักยภาพของมันหรือยัง!

อ่านต่อ »